Day Four of Listener Week. One Listener wanted us to talk about how you get over falling out with your best friend. Doreen and Virginia wondered if they're members of the longest running Book Club - which began in 1965. Twenty-year-old Sophie Taylor got in touch seeking advice for female entrepreneurs like herself . And Wandja Kimani asked us to discuss carving out a life in a community when you find yourself in a minority.
